Quote:A decade after losing millions of dollars from the collapse of Comcast SportsNet Houston, the Astros and Rockets are negotiating to get back into the regional sports network business as owners of AT&T SportsNet Southwest.(Houston Chronicle)
If negotiations proceed as planned, according to sources with knowledge of the talks, the teams will create a new business entity that will assume ownership of the network from Warner Bros. Discovery.

The Houston channel, which will get a new name once the Astros and Rockets take ownership, will join team-owned RSNs in several markets, among them New York, Seattle and Boston, that thus far have avoided the worst of the financial woes enveloping Bally Sports and AT&T SportsNet.
Under the proposal, the Rockets and Astros would acquire AT&T SportsNet Southwest and with it the license to telecast their games. The Astros owned 60 percent and the Rockets 40 percent of their previous joint venture before bringing in Comcast as a partner in 2010 for the CSN Houston launch, but it was unclear if those percentages would continue for the new venture.
